iT邦幫忙

0

個人筆記 維修單派工 關聯表

  • 分享至 

  • xImage
  •  

開始繪製維修單派工關聯表,畫錯蠻多次。我學習的方式,先在網路上找相關的圖參考,思考後進行繪製動作。畫好當下給朋友看,朋友會給出適當的建議及協助理清思緒。

問題一:命名方式
朋友:建議先去看駝峰式大小寫的命名法
參考網址:
https://zh.wikipedia.org/wiki/%E9%A7%9D%E5%B3%B0%E5%BC%8F%E5%A4%A7%E5%B0%8F%E5%AF%AB
我:知道問題出在哪,命名全用大寫。
朋友:這是命名慣例,雖沒有絕對與強制,但是為了增加識別和可讀性。

問題二:畫得過於簡單少了些資料表
剛開始只畫到主流程式用到的資料
朋友:系統不會只有這樣,還會放其它的資料庫欄位,管理者帳號密碼都應分開放置。試想現在只建立phpmyadmin的表,實際上你根本不清楚,它們關聯有多深。如若有天維護系統時,把某個關鍵刪除,那其它系統就崩潰了。但此刻有這張表,就能清楚得知,何處能進行變動。其它維護工程師,也能清楚明白。

問題三:資料表欄位名稱問題
我:假設員工資料表表裡有取Id的欄位,排休表也能有取相同名稱的嗎?
朋友:可以,只要不搞混就好。有時怕撈資料時,自己搞混。
我:大致上了解意思,就像在人潮多的大街上,大喊要找誰時,湊巧有同名的人一起回頭。

問題一解決方式:我採用大駝峰式命名法
問題二解決方式:繼續修改資料表
問題三解決方式:盡量不取容易搞混的名稱

維修單派工關聯表完成圖:
https://drive.google.com/file/d/1Lii1jwdn2nwJU8R_3qdMwfGR2D5r8yj2/view?usp=sharing
https://ithelp.ithome.com.tw/upload/images/20220414/20147889uvyWT3sZDH.png


圖片
  直播研討會
圖片
{{ item.channelVendor }} {{ item.webinarstarted }} |
{{ formatDate(item.duration) }}
直播中

1 則留言

1
海綿寶寶
iT邦大神 1 級 ‧ 2022-04-15 08:45:09

如果你心理素質夠強
受得了冷嘲熱諷的話

你可以把你做的成果
貼到「技術問答」區
不必詳述你的背景/想法
只要徵求意見

相信會比放在這裡(沒人看)
得到相對多的批評指教

語文畫 iT邦新手 5 級 ‧ 2022-04-15 11:45:43 檢舉

因剛開始使用這網站,想說只是個人筆記所以就發在這區,謝謝您給我的建議。/images/emoticon/emoticon12.gif

https://ithelp.ithome.com.tw/upload/images/20220415/20001787i4m9a8OLel.png

我要留言

立即登入留言